What does insurance sales training provided mean?

'Insurance Sales Training Provided' refers to job positions where the employer offers training to new hires who may not have prior experience in insurance sales. This training typically covers product knowledge, sales techniques, regulatory compliance, and customer service skills. The goal is to prepare employees to successfully sell insurance products and pass any required licensing exams. It is an entry point for individuals looking to start a career in insurance sales without needing previous industry experience. The employer invests in your development, making it accessible for motivated candidates from various backgrounds.

What are some common challenges faced by new insurance sales representatives, and how does the training program help address them?

New insurance sales representatives often encounter challenges such as building a client base, understanding complex insurance products, and overcoming initial rejection from prospects. The training program is designed to address these hurdles by providing comprehensive product knowledge, effective sales techniques, and mentorship from experienced colleagues. This supportive environment helps new hires develop confidence, learn how to handle objections, and gradually build lasting relationships with clients, setting them up for long-term success in the industry.

Insurance Sales Training Provided focuses on equipping individuals with sales skills and industry knowledge, often as part of onboarding. An Insurance Agent is a licensed professional actively selling insurance policies. While training prepares you for the role, being an agent involves licensing, client interaction, and ongoing sales activities.
